Know what to do at home and at a friend's house.
Precautions should be taken to prevent exposure to peanuts in your home and when your child visits friends.
- Be sure that no food containing peanuts or any peanut product is served.
- Remember that food can be easily contaminated. For instance, if a knife that has been used to spread peanut butter is then dipped in a jar of jelly, that jelly is no longer safe.
- If peanut butter or peanuts have been eaten recently, clean tabletops and counters with soap and water.
- If there are young children who may have wandered around the house with peanut butter on their hands, clean their toys and other surfaces they may have touched.
- Don't share cups, water bottles, or toothbrushes.
